Sixth Annual Report of the Board of Education


Book Description

Excerpt from Sixth Annual Report of the Board of Education: Together With the Sixth Annual Report of the Secretary of the Board The subject Of school libraries was further introduced in the Fourth Annual Report Of the Board, and the volumes which then were before the public, were spoken Of in terms Of high commendation.
